Abstract

The present invention is a vertical resonant surface-emitting laser, and more particularly, a method for making a micro-laser that can be emitted to the upper surface of resonance structures by forming electrodes on the side surface of the resonance structures. By forming the electrodes injecting the current to the active layer on the side surface of resonators, the electrodes may be formed more easily on the fine micro-laser. Moreover, the current is more efficiently injected to the inside the active layer due to the side electrode surrounding an upper glass layer and emitter, and the laser may be operated even with a smaller start current, and serial resistance of the resonators may be reduced.
